2. File Formats

The term “file formats” denotes the specific encoding structure used to store digital audio data. In the context of “pirates of the caribbean theme download,” file formats directly influence compatibility, audio quality, and file size, thereby affecting user experience. The selection of a file format is a critical determinant of how effectively the music can be stored, transferred, and played across various devices and software applications. For instance, a user intending to listen to the “Pirates of the Caribbean” theme on a smartphone, computer, or media player must consider the supported file formats of each device. Incompatibility can render the downloaded file unusable. For example, an older MP3 player might not support lossless formats like FLAC, while a modern smartphone can typically handle a wider range of audio file types.

Common file formats encountered when acquiring the “Pirates of the Caribbean” theme include MP3, AAC, WAV, and FLAC. MP3 and AAC are lossy formats, employing compression algorithms to reduce file size, which results in a trade-off in audio quality. These formats are prevalent due to their widespread compatibility and smaller file sizes, making them suitable for streaming and storing large music libraries. WAV and FLAC are lossless formats, preserving the original audio data without compression. This results in superior audio quality but also larger file sizes. Individuals seeking the highest fidelity listening experience typically opt for lossless formats, provided their devices and storage capacity allow. The practical significance of understanding these distinctions lies in the ability to make informed decisions based on individual needs and technical constraints. Someone prioritizing portability and storage efficiency might choose MP3, while an audiophile seeking pristine audio reproduction will likely prefer FLAC.

5. Audio Quality

Audio quality is a crucial consideration in the context of obtaining a “pirates of the caribbean theme download.” The fidelity and clarity of the audio file directly impact the listening experience, influencing the emotional impact and overall enjoyment of the musical composition. The perceived quality is determined by various technical factors and user preferences, all of which are intertwined in the selection process.

  • Bit Rate and Encoding

    Bit rate, measured in kilobits per second (kbps), directly correlates with audio quality. Higher bit rates generally indicate more data is preserved during encoding, resulting in improved sound reproduction. MP3 files, for instance, are commonly available in bit rates ranging from 128 kbps to 320 kbps. The encoding algorithm also plays a role; more efficient codecs can achieve higher quality at lower bit rates. A poorly encoded file, even with a high bit rate, may exhibit artifacts or distortions. In the context of “pirates of the caribbean theme download,” listeners often seek files with bit rates of 256 kbps or higher to minimize audible compression artifacts and maximize fidelity.

  • Lossy vs. Lossless Formats

    Audio quality is fundamentally affected by the format used for the “pirates of the caribbean theme download”. Lossy formats, such as MP3 and AAC, employ compression techniques that discard some audio data to reduce file size. This results in a trade-off between file size and audio fidelity. Lossless formats, such as FLAC and WAV, preserve all original audio data, resulting in superior sound reproduction. However, lossless files are significantly larger in size. An audiophile acquiring the “Pirates of the Caribbean” theme might prioritize a lossless format to capture the full dynamic range and sonic details of the orchestral score. Conversely, someone with limited storage space may opt for a lossy format to balance quality and file size.

  • Source Recording and Mastering

    The quality of the original recording and mastering process is paramount. Even with a high bit rate and lossless format, a poorly recorded or mastered track will exhibit sonic deficiencies. Factors such as microphone placement, mixing techniques, and mastering compression all contribute to the final audio quality. When considering a “pirates of the caribbean theme download”, it is essential to seek out recordings from reputable sources that prioritize quality production. Remastered versions of the theme may offer improved audio fidelity compared to older releases.

  • Playback Equipment

    The playback equipment significantly influences the perceived audio quality. High-resolution audio files, even when perfectly encoded, may not be fully appreciated when played through low-quality speakers or headphones. The frequency response, dynamic range, and distortion characteristics of the playback device determine the accuracy and clarity of the audio reproduction. Individuals prioritizing audio quality for their “pirates of the caribbean theme download” often invest in high-quality headphones or speakers to fully appreciate the nuances of the music. The effectiveness of a high-quality audio file is diminished when paired with inadequate playback hardware.

  • Codec Support

    Codecs (coder-decoders) are software algorithms used to compress and decompress audio data. Different devices and media players support different codecs. A “pirates of the caribbean theme download” encoded with a codec not supported by the user’s device will be unplayable. Common audio codecs include MP3, AAC, FLAC, and WAV. While MP3 and AAC enjoy widespread support, less common codecs may require the installation of additional software or plugins. Some devices may also have hardware-level support for specific codecs, resulting in more efficient playback. Checking the codec compatibility of the target device before acquiring a “pirates of the caribbean theme download” is essential to ensure seamless playback and prevent compatibility issues.
